Title: Venators Promised Forged

Author: Devri Walls

Year of Publication: 2019

Genre: Young Adult Fantasy

Number of Pages: 428

Promises ForgedSummary: From Goodreads: “It has been mere days in the world of Eon, where Rune Jenkins, her twin brother Ryker, and their friend Grey have been trapped, fighting for their lives. After discovering the truth of their ancestry, the three are far from home, and far from anything resembling their mundane lives of the past.


While Ryker is still held captive by the eerily beautiful Zio and her goblins, Grey falls into the clutches of Feena, the Fae queen. She begins to drain his soul bit by bit to feed her dark underground garden, and Grey has no hope of escaping on his own.

It is now up to Rune to save Grey, as his precious time slips away inexorably. But the Council has denied her permission to embark on a rescue mission, until she can harness her Venator gifts and prove herself capable of venturing into the Fae queen’s territory. As Rune discovers that promises in Eon are forged with life-or-death consequences, she realizes that she must act quickly, or else be swallowed and Grey along with her by the dangers of Eon.”

When I was asked if I was interested in being part of the blog tour for the second installment of the Venators series, I immediately said yes. I thought the first installment of this series was wonderful, and I knew I was in for a treat as soon as I started reading Promises Forged. I don’t want to say too much about the plot of this book, because I don’t want to spoil the first book for you, but I will say that it picks up right where the first book left off.

I don’t know what I like more about this book, the world that Devri created or the characters. The world is dark, twisted, full of manipulation, hierarchy, customs, and tons of different creatures and species. There is so much world-building, and I loved every minute of it.

The characters are interesting, and they have so many layers and motivations. I loved Rune and Grey’s development, and I especially loved watching Rune grow in confidence and as a Venator. I loved learning more about the council members, finding out what motivates them, and watching them use manipulation to their advantage. I liked finding out a bit more about Zio and Ryker, and I can’t wait to see how that plotline develops later on in the series. Finally, I also absolutely love Beltran, and I hope to see more of him and Rune working together in the rest of the series.

This book was full of action, adventure, and suspense. It was full of twists and turns, epic fight scenes, and it had a handful of tender moments. It kept me on the edge of my seat, and I wanted to keep reading to find out what was going to happen next. I like that the world that Devri created is open, leaving a ton of room for more action-packed adventures in future books.

Overall, this book was fantastic. I highly recommend picking up Magic Unleashed and Promises Forged if you like fantasy books. The world-building and character-development are fantastic, and I can’t wait to see what happens in book three!

Rating: 4.5 Stars!

About the Author: Devri Walls is a US and international bestselling author. Having released five novels to date, she specializes in all things fantasy and paranormal. She is best known for her uncanny world-building skills and her intricate storylines, and her ability to present this all in an easy-to-digest voice. Now gearing up for her first national release, Devri is excited to introduce her sixth novel, book one in the Venators series. She loves to engage with her loyal following through social media and online sessions she organizes for her readers. Devri lives in Meridian, Idaho with her husband and two kids. When not writing she can be found teaching voice lessons, reading, cooking or binge-watching whatever show catches her fancy.
